In this podcast we talk about the proposal for the upcoming November election bond on the ballot in Box Elder County. There are a few things reference.
Cost per square foot to build
Elementary - $ 481
High Schools - $ 449
Middle schools - $382

In this podcast we talk to 2 teachers of the DLI program and the district director. We talk about the long term benefits for signing your student up for the program. BESD offers 4 schools with Spanish DLI and one with Chinese.
